heroku - Heroku 免费套餐 - 单个应用程序可以使用所有 Dyno 配额吗?
问题描述
如果我只有一个活跃的应用程序,它是否有可能花费所有免费的 Dyno 小时配额?
我的应用程序是一个始终处于活动状态的 PHP 进程(while (true) { do_something})。我以工人身份启动此过程。
我认为免费的 Dyno 小时配额就像真正的小时一样,因此您每天最多可以花费 24 小时。但是,如果我使用“heroku ps -a app”命令连续两天查看剩余的空闲时间配额,那么我会发现我每天花费的时间超过 24 小时。
另一个问题,你有多少小时的爱好计划?
解决方案
如果您正在运行 2 个 dyno(例如,一个 web dyno 和一个 worker dyno),它们将各自使用 24 小时,一天总共使用 48 个 dyno 小时。当然,实际上,如果测功机在一天中的一部分时间睡觉,每个时间可能不到 24 小时。
我解决了禁用网络 Dyno 的问题。
推荐阅读
- reactjs - 为什么我们从历史中导入 createBrowserHistory?以及为什么我们将它传递给路由器
有一个名为 的文件
"createBrowserHistory.d.ts"
,那个文件有什么用?下面的代码没有错误,但是当我尝试运行它时,它会显示空白?为什么这样?<
- cluster-analysis - 聚类方法会解决这个嘈杂的匹配问题吗?
- javascript - 检测与图像和画布上的对象的碰撞
- php - 给定文本存储为降价,如何使用 php 进行文本预览
- amazon-web-services - VPC 外部的 AWS Lambda 和 RDS
- python - 在pyqt4 python中的QTableWidget中存储列表值
- python - 如何在元素列表中找到最大的数字,可能是非唯一的?
- react-native - react-native:在设备上运行时不会下载包
- reactjs - 如何关闭梳子更漂亮。与创建反应应用程序?
- reactjs - 可以像使用 setAutoFreeze(true/false) 的 immer 一样重新匹配 immer 插件控制自动冻结开关吗?